创建数据库的时候要指定编码格式
ENGINE=INNODB DEFAULT CHARSET=utf8;set names utf8;

解决方案 »

  1.   

    xiaopai__007() ( ) 信誉:100    Blog  2007-02-26 15:11:52  得分: 0  
     
     
       创建数据库的时候要指定编码格式
    ENGINE=INNODB DEFAULT CHARSET=utf8;set names utf8;
      
     
    我的数据库本来就是utf8的,创建时还需要?
    嗯,我一会2再试试
      

  2.   

    创建数据库的时候要指定编码格式
    ENGINE=INNODB DEFAULT CHARSET=utf8;set names utf8;
    这个已然试过,没什么变化....
    用命令行查看出现乱码,我想是因为命令行的属性为简体中文(GBK)————这个可以通过命令行属性看到难道是过滤器有问题?
      

  3.   

    XP中文操作系统
    tomcat已设置 URIEncoding="UTF-8"
      

  4.   

    URIEncoding还是URIncoding
    网上有很多...需要看一下文档确认...但是都不行啊
      

  5.   

    tomcat的URIEncoding="gbk"设置可保证通过URL传递的中文按GBK正确解码。
    数据库mysql用utf8不对吧?这样从数据库来的中文到网页上会乱码。
      

  6.   

    tomcat的URIEncoding="gbk"设置可保证通过URL传递的中文按GBK正确解码。
    数据库mysql用utf8不对吧?这样从数据库来的中文到网页上会乱码。......GBK...我要用日文怎么办...